I'd like to get everyone's opinion on the best set up (though not crazy in price) for hooking up my new iPod Photo (40GB) in my car, to play. I have a cassette deck, which right now I play my portable cd player in the car by using the cassette deck adapter. I know they have these for the iPod as well; but I hate lots of cords. I'm working really hard to go all wireless for most of my Apple stuff, in general. I realize I can't do this in my car, but what would be the best thing to get to play the iPod in the car, without lots of wires/mess from a recharger, as well as the tape deck adapter, etc. I've heard about the FM Transmitters, but have heard lots of mixed reviews on them? Thoughts? Experiences on any/all? Thanks!

I used to use the Griffin iTrip until it just stopped working all of a sudden... it wouldn't find a station at all (tried installing just one, then some, then all of the stations... none worked). It all seemed to coincide with one of the iTunes updates. I've looked everywhere for any sort of troubleshooting, and no go... so now I'm back to the cassette adapter, and in all honesty I think the cassette adapted sounds alot better than the iTrip ever did: no minute scratches in the background, it can go to a much higher volume..
